Evening Event Manager
Brown University is seeking an Evening Event Manager to coordinate student activities and events during evenings and weekends. The role involves providing support to student event organizers and ensuring events run smoothly and safely.

Responsibilities
The Evening Event Manager has primary responsibility for overall coordination of student activities, events, and departmental facilities during the evenings and weekends
The manager provides on-site support and advice to student event organizers
Working collaboratively with student managers, they ensure that events on evenings and weekends run smoothly and safely
Qualification
Required
Event planning and management experience, including demonstrated experience with events with alcohol, preferably with some experience in a college environment
Ability to work Thursday, Friday and/or Saturday evenings and weekend days throughout the academic year (late August through late May with summers and winter break off)
Must be available the last weekend in April to work Spring Weekend and in May, the week prior to Memorial Day, for Senior Week
Excellent communication, organizational and conflict resolution skills
Ability to relate to students and understand the purpose and value of student-run campus events and programs
Preferred
Brown experience helpful but not required
